Analysis and Design of Autonomous Remote Monitoring System for Underwater Targets

Article Preview

Abstract:

Demands for remote monitoring of underwater targets are analyzed, and the basic concept of autonomous underwater target remote monitoring system is put forward in this paper. The working principle of autonomous underwater target remote monitoring system, the composition of the structure and the overall design of function modules are given. The underwater target detection device is designed in detail.Through the analysis and design of the system, the feasibility and practicability of autonomous underwater target remote monitoring system are fully demonstrated, which has broad application prospects in the water information network construction.It will further improve the detection and reconnaissance capability for remote underwater targets.
